Modern car keys aren't simple pieces of metal you can cut at a kiosk in the mall. Transponder chips are sophisticated electronic devices that need to be programmed to work with the security system of your vehicle. The majority of locksmiths for cars can handle this task, so it is recommended to leave it to them.

If your car is equipped with an immobilizer, then you'll require a key that has a transponder chip to activate it. This type of key is required by the majority of owners to disable the anti-theft system in their vehicle which was made mandatory in 1995. Most locksmiths can copy and program this type of key, but you'll need to call them if you require it outside of normal business hours.

You can also buy a blank key at an affordable cost and then try to program it yourself. This is a high-risk strategy that requires a good understanding of electronics. It's worth a shot in case you're not ready to spend money on professional services.

Blank reprogramme car key keys are available at a variety of auto parts stores and pharmacies. You can buy a keyfob from major retailers or even online shops that specialize in automotive technology. Some auto parts stores offer key programming in-store. These services are typically offered one hour prior to the time the store closes if an employee with training is present. Some manufacturers do not allow this practice, and only allow dealerships to issue keys for their cars.
